Abstract

The utility model discloses a grinding device for sword processing, which comprises an operation table, wherein support columns are fixedly arranged at the bottom of the operation table and symmetrically arranged, a processing box is fixedly arranged at the top of the operation table, a mounting plate is fixedly arranged at one side of the operation table, a motor is fixedly arranged at the top of the processing box, a fixed rod is fixedly arranged at one side of the processing box and symmetrically arranged, a cross beam is arranged at one side of the fixed rod and extends to the other side of the symmetrical fixed rod through the fixed rod, and heads are arranged on the two sides of the cross beam in a threaded manner, so that the simple and convenient sword processing and grinding device can be fixed according to swords of different sizes, is convenient to grind, process and take, has short time consumption, improves the processing efficiency, polishes the fixed swords, improves the speed and solves the problem of complicated manual polishing process, the raise dust produced because of high frequency is polished has been prevented to the effect of polishing has been influenced.

Background
Grinding is a machining method for removing materials, which refers to a machining method for cutting off redundant materials on a workpiece by using an abrasive and a grinding tool, grinding is one of the widely applied material removal methods, machining belongs to finish machining (machining modes such as rough machining, finish machining, heat treatment and the like), machining amount is small, precision is high, and the machining method is widely applied in the machining industry.
The prior product still has the following problems in the using process:
1. the clamp of the existing knife and sword grinding equipment generally fastens a workpiece by means of screws and the like, but the mode is inconvenient and time-consuming when the workpiece is taken and placed, and the mode can cause extremely low grinding efficiency, delay production efficiency and reduce yield when large-scale processing is carried out;
2. most of the prior sword grinding is manual grinding, firstly, a grinding wheel is used for rough grinding, a person holds a sword blank to slowly grind on the rotating grinding wheel, then, carborundum is used for carrying out fine grinding on the sword blank for multiple times, and finally, polishing is carried out by adding polishing paste on polishing cloth, so that the process is complicated, the production efficiency is low, and the production speed of the prior required quantity is not met;
3. in the manual grinding sword and knife process, no water spray cooling is performed in the grinding wheel coarse grinding stage due to manual grinding, and dust is easily generated to influence the grinding effect.

Referring to fig. 1-4, an embodiment of the present invention provides a technical solution: the utility model provides a sword processing is with grinding equipment, includes operation panel 1, 1 bottom fixed mounting of operation panel has support column 2, 2 symmetrical installations of support column, 1 top fixed mounting of operation panel has processing case 4, 1 one side fixed mounting of operation panel has mounting panel 3, 4 top fixed mounting of processing case have motor 5, 4 one side fixed mounting of processing case has dead lever 8, 8 symmetrical installations of dead lever, dead lever 8 one side is installed crossbeam 6, crossbeam 6 runs through dead lever 8 and extends to 8 opposite sides of symmetrical dead lever, 6 both sides screw threads of crossbeam are installed and are protected head 7, protect the installation of head 7, make things convenient for the equipment and the dismantlement of crossbeam 6, and the installation and the fixing of crossbeam 6 have made things convenient for the installation and the fixed of crossbeam 6.
The outer wall cover of crossbeam 6 has link 9, link 9 evenly distributed, curtain 10 is held through the shelf centre gripping in the link 9 bottom, and the installation of link 9 conveniently fixes curtain 10 at crossbeam 6 outer wall, plays a effect of sheltering from, prevents to add the income raise dust that produces and wafts the outside man-hour.
The top of the operating platform 1 is provided with a sliding groove 11, the sliding groove 11 penetrates through the operating platform 1 and extends to the inside of the operating platform 1, the sliding grooves 11 are symmetrically formed, a sliding block 12 is movably mounted at the top of the sliding groove 11, one side of the sliding block 12 is embedded into the sliding groove 11, the other side of the sliding block is embedded into the symmetrical sliding groove 11, the sliding groove 11 is installed, and the sliding block 12 can slide at the top of the operating platform 1 to fix the sword.
3 top fixed mounting of mounting panel has driving motor 13, driving motor 13 one end fixed mounting has output shaft 14, the welding of the 14 other ends of output shaft has lead screw 15, lead screw 15 runs through operation panel 1, slider 12, extends to inside the operation panel 1, and slider 12 removes in spout 11 through the rotation of lead screw 15, can fix according to the sword of equidimension not, makes things convenient for abrasive machining to take, and the time spent is short, has improved machining efficiency.
Electric putter 16 is installed to 5 bottoms of motor, electric putter 16 runs through inside processing case 4 extends to processing case 4, threaded connection piece 17 is installed to electric putter 16 bottom, threaded connection piece 17 bottom threaded connection has mill 18, and electric putter 16 and mill 18 are polished the sword that is fixed through motor 5's power, have improved speed, have solved the loaded down with trivial details problem of artifical sanding process.
The outer wall of the processing box 4 is provided with a water adding pipe 19, the water adding pipe 19 extends into the processing box 4, a hollow pipe 20 is installed on one side of the water adding pipe 19, the hollow pipe 20 is of a hollow structure, a connecting pipe 21 is installed on one side of the hollow pipe 20, a spray head 22 is installed on the other side of the connecting pipe 21, the spray head 22, the connecting pipe 21 and the water adding pipe 19 are added, the knife and sword which are polished correctly are subjected to spray wetting treatment, dust generated by polishing due to high frequency is prevented, polishing effect is influenced, and the water adding pipe 19 and the connecting pipe 21 are fixed to the hollow pipe 20.
The working principle is as follows: during the use, at first the (window) curtain 10 of link 9 bottom of having through 6 outer wall covers of crossbeam pulls open, put into the sword, according to the size of sword after that, drive lead screw 15 through driving motor 13 and rotate, slider 12 slides thereupon and fixes to suitable position, then provide power for electric putter 16 and mill 18 through motor 5, polish fixed sword, secondly when polishing, filler pipe 19 passes through the combination of hollow tube 20 and connecting pipe 21, pass through shower nozzle 22 blowout with water, the sword of just polishing is being spouted wet-proofly and is handled, the raise dust of production has been prevented because of high frequency polishes, thereby the effect of polishing has been influenced, the convenient installation of hollow tube 20 fixes filler pipe 19 and connecting pipe 21.
